Introduction

The global green technology and sustainability market is undergoing remarkable transformation as governments, businesses, and consumers increasingly prioritize environmentally responsible solutions. Green technology refers to innovative products, systems, and practices designed to minimize environmental impact, conserve natural resources, and promote sustainable development.

As climate change concerns intensify and energy costs continue to rise, industries across the globe are rapidly adopting sustainable technologies to reduce carbon footprints and improve operational efficiency. Green technology spans multiple sectors, including renewable energy, energy-efficient systems, waste management, green building solutions, carbon management, sustainable agriculture, and smart transportation.

The rising pressure to comply with environmental regulations, coupled with growing environmental, social, and governance (ESG) commitments among corporations, is accelerating market growth. Businesses are increasingly integrating sustainability initiatives into their long-term strategies to enhance resilience, improve brand reputation, and meet investor expectations.

How Big is the Green Technology and Sustainability Market?

The global green technology and sustainability market size is expected to be valued at US$33.3 billion in 2026 and is projected to reach approximately US$152.7 billion by 2033, expanding at a robust CAGR of 21.4% during the forecast period from 2026 to 2033.

This impressive growth is being fueled by tightening environmental regulations worldwide, increasing pressure from rising energy costs, and a surge in corporate ESG commitments. Businesses across industries are investing heavily in sustainable solutions to improve environmental performance, reduce costs, and align with global sustainability goals.

The increasing adoption of renewable energy technologies, energy-efficient systems, carbon reduction solutions, and sustainable manufacturing practices is expected to further strengthen market expansion throughout the forecast period.

Key Market Drivers

  1. Tightening Global Environmental Regulations

Governments worldwide are implementing stricter regulations to reduce greenhouse gas emissions and environmental degradation. Industries are being required to adopt cleaner technologies and sustainable operational practices, significantly boosting demand for green technologies.

Carbon neutrality targets and climate-focused policies are encouraging companies to invest in sustainable infrastructure and low-emission technologies.

  1. Rising Energy Cost Pressures

Increasing global energy prices are encouraging organizations to adopt energy-efficient technologies to reduce operational expenses. Businesses are increasingly investing in renewable energy systems, smart energy management solutions, and sustainable infrastructure to improve cost efficiency.

Energy optimization technologies are becoming critical for industries seeking long-term profitability.

  1. Growing Corporate ESG Commitments

Environmental, social, and governance (ESG) strategies have become central to corporate decision-making. Investors, regulators, and consumers are demanding stronger sustainability commitments from organizations.

As a result, companies are actively investing in carbon tracking systems, renewable energy adoption, sustainable supply chains, and green manufacturing initiatives.

  1. Technological Advancements in Sustainability Solutions

The integration of smart technologies such as AI, blockchain, and IoT is enhancing sustainability performance. Smart grids, predictive maintenance, automated energy management, and intelligent waste reduction systems are improving operational efficiency and environmental outcomes.

Regional Analysis

North America

North America holds a significant share of the green technology and sustainability market due to stringent environmental policies, high renewable energy adoption, and strong ESG investment activity. The United States and Canada continue to invest heavily in clean energy and smart infrastructure projects.

Europe

Europe remains one of the leading regions due to ambitious carbon neutrality goals and aggressive climate regulations. Countries such as Germany, France, and the United Kingdom are focusing heavily on renewable energy expansion and sustainable industrial transformation.

Asia Pacific

Asia Pacific is expected to witness the fastest growth during the forecast period. Rapid urbanization, industrialization, and increasing government support for renewable energy projects are fueling market expansion.

Countries such as China, India, Japan, and South Korea are making significant investments in green infrastructure, electric mobility, and sustainable manufacturing.

Latin America

Latin America is gradually emerging as a promising market due to rising renewable energy investments and increasing awareness regarding environmental sustainability.

Middle East & Africa

The Middle East & Africa region is seeing growing adoption of sustainable technologies, particularly in renewable energy, desalination systems, and smart urban infrastructure.
